Kalamnuri Assembly Election Result 2014

Maharashtra ·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 2014

Tarfe Santosh Kautika of Indian National Congress won the Kalamnuri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Maharashtra in the 2014 state assembly election, securing 67,104 votes (34.60% vote share). The runner-up was Gajanan Vitthalrao Ghuge (Shiv Sena) with 56,568 votes.

A total of 12 candidates contested this assembly seat. State Assembly elections elect Members of the Legislative Assembly (MLAs) using India's First-Past-The-Post (FPTP) system, and the party or alliance winning a majority of seats forms the state government. Position Candidate Name Votes Votes% Party
1 Tarfe Santosh Kautika 67104 34.60% Indian National Congress
2 Gajanan Vitthalrao Ghuge 56568 29.20% Shiv Sena
3 Shivaji Mane 38085 19.60% Nationalist Congress Party
4 Adv.Madhavrao Naik 17474 9.00% Rashtriya Samaj Paksha
5 Dr.Dilip Maske (NAIK) 8032 4.10% Bahujan Samaj Party
6 Adkine Sunil Madhavrao 1623 0.80% Maharashtra Navnirman Sena
7 Chandramoni Sharavn Paikrao 804 0.40% Bahujan Mukti Party
8 Siraj Ahemad Seed Miya 759 0.40% Independent
9 Wadhe Ravindra Tukaram 707 0.40% Bharipa Bahujan Mahasangh
10 Khude Vishwanath Pandurang 609 0.30% Republican Party Of India
11 Shaikh Musa Sk Mohammed 552 0.30% Independent
12 Paikrao Sunil Dasharath 501 0.30% Independent
